  • Beautiful place... Atmosphere... Ruins of a Franciscan church and hospital. It's amazing that people knew how to build this way in the 13th century. In front of the ruins there is a monument to Luke Wadding, a chronicler and Franciscan monk born in Waterford. Amazing atmosphere, a must see. Near the tourist information in the so-called Viking triangle.
